ZAGREB, Oct 1 (Hina) - The Croatian Government has passed a
regulation on establishing an office for associations which are
entitled to support from the state budget.
Homeland War associations are not within the new Office for
Associations' scope of activities, but will remain under the care
of the Ministry for Croatian Homeland War Defenders.
The Government has also accepted a Croatian delegation's report
from the seventh round of bilateral negotiations concerning
Croatia's application for full membership of the World Trade
Organisation (WTO).
The Government has authorised the delegation to continue with the
negotiations, which should be finished by April 1, 1999.
A proposal on establishing a Croatian honorary consulate in Hungary
with its headquarters in Nagykanizsa has been accepted. Mijo
Karagic has been proposed as the honorary consul.
The establishment of an honorary consulate in Israel based in
Jerusalem has been proposed, and Dan Baram has been suggested as the
honorary consul.
Dusko Grabovac has been proposed as Croatia's general consul in
Italy, the Government Communications Office reported.
